The History of the Woffenden Surname

The surname Woffenden has a fascinating history that dates back centuries. The name is of English origin and is believed to be locational, deriving from "Woffenden" or a similar place name. It is thought to have originated from a small village or hamlet in the county of Yorkshire, England. The name likely evolved from Old English or Old Norse words, and its meaning is uncertain.

Throughout history, surnames like Woffenden were often used to identify people based on their place of origin, occupation, or physical characteristics. It is likely that the Woffenden surname was originally given to individuals who lived in or near the village of Woffenden or who had some connection to the area.

Spread of the Woffenden Surname

According to available data, the incidence of the Woffenden surname is highest in England, particularly in the region of England. There are 247 documented instances of the surname in England, indicating that it has a long-standing presence in the country. The surname is also found in other English-speaking countries, including the United States, Canada, New Zealand, and Australia, with varying levels of incidence.

The Woffenden surname has a relatively lower incidence in other countries, such as Rwanda, the Philippines, France, Jersey, and Thailand. However, these occurrences suggest that the name has also spread beyond its English origins and has been adopted by individuals in different parts of the world.
